  Tuition Exchange Program (TEP)

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S

Question - What is the role of Tuition Exchange, Inc. (TE)?

Answer - Tuition Exchange, Inc. (TE) is a nonprofit organization based in Washington, D.C. which records exchange scholarships, enrolls interested colleges and universities as members, prepares and distributes membership lists, and develops and implements policies that promote balanced exchanges. TE scholarships are granted by member institutions, not by Tuition Exchange, Inc. The officers and directors of Tuition Exchange, Inc. disclaim responsibility for any misunderstandings among applicants, participants and institutions concerning the value and duration of scholarships or circumstances which might result in early termination of such scholarships. Tuition Exchange, Inc. continues to seek ways to make TE scholarships more widely available to qualified applicants.
